I’m an executive leadership coach, facilitator, and speaker, but more than that, I’m someone who cares deeply about how we show up at work and in life. I help leaders in corporate organizations, start-ups and non-profits move through transitions, career shifts, leadership changes, life pivots, with clarity, confidence, and a renewed sense of possibility.

For over 20 years, I built my career in the MedTech and consumer goods industries, working in high-pressure environments across different countries, functions, and teams. Along the way, I coached and mentored leaders at every level, supporting them to grow, adapt, bounce back, and step fully into who they are meant to be as leaders.

I’ve navigated a lot of change myself. Every transition, whether it was changing industries, moving countries, or stepping into bigger roles, taught me something new about leadership, resilience, and the courage it takes to evolve.

Leaving corporate life was one of the biggest transitions of all. It opened my eyes to a new way of working, and of living. I came to believe that if we want healthier workplaces, we have to start by supporting the people in them. That’s what drives me today: helping leaders lead from a place that’s more grounded, more human, and more sustainable.

I’m also proud to coach with How Women Lead, a national network of powerhouse women taking seats at the table, on boards, in venture funding, and in the fight for gender equity.

Experience

  • 25 years of senior global leadership experience in two Fortune 50 companies across different sectors, continents and functions.
  • MedTech Industry: Johnson & Johnson
  • Fast Moving Consumer Goods: Procter & Gamble
  • Volunteer at Nine Lives Foundation, Second Harvest, Village Harvest, Pacific Beach Coalition, Operation Smile, Thunderbird for Good

Accredited by:

Training

  • Coach Training at Coactive Training Institute (CTI)
  • Interpersonal Dynamics T-Group training at Stanford Graduate School of Business
  • Certified Mindfulness Meditation Coach at MNDFL, NYC
  • Visible Impact at How Women Lead
  • Positive Intelligence (PQ)
  • Institute for Women’s Entrepreneurship at Cornell
  • Master in Business and Economics at KU Leuven Campus Antwerp in Belgium
  • Master in Business Administration at Thunderbird, School of Global Management Arizona, USA
